Allenhurst is a city in Liberty County, Georgia, United States. It is a part of the Hinesville metropolitan area. As of the 2020 census, the city had a population of 816.
Allenhurst was platted in 1910 by B. H. Allen, the proprietor of a local sawmill. A post office has been in operation since 1909.

The United States Postal Service operates the Allenhurst Post Office. The current mayor of Allenhurst is James Willis.
The Liberty County School District operates public schools that serve Allenhurst.
